What you’ll help with:
- Companionship – being a friendly face & preventing loneliness
- Personal Care – all aspects of personal hygiene
- Medication – collecting prescriptions & providing reminders
- Mealtimes – preparing tasty meals
- Housekeeping – keeping their home just the way they like it
- Mobility – help with getting around
What you’ll need:
- Strong communication & interpersonal skills
- Patience, compassion & a positive attitude at all times
- A responsible, dedicated & flexible approach to your work

How to prepare for a job interview at City and County Healthcare Group
✨Know Your Role Inside Out
Before the interview, make sure you understand what being a Live In Care Assistant entails. Familiarise yourself with the responsibilities like companionship, personal care, and medication management. This will help you answer questions confidently and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.
✨Showcase Your Soft Skills
This job requires strong communication, patience, and compassion. Think of examples from your past experiences where you've demonstrated these skills. Be ready to share stories that highlight your ability to connect with others and handle challenging situations with a positive attitude.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are some insightful questions about the company culture, training opportunities, or how they support their staff. This shows that you’re not just looking for any job, but that you’re genuinely interested in being part of their team.
✨Dress Appropriately and Be Punctual
First impressions matter! Dress smartly and arrive on time for your interview. This demonstrates professionalism and respect for the interviewer's time. Plus, it sets a positive tone for the rest of the conversation.
